mysql查询有哪些数据库
-
在 MySQL 中,要查询所有数据库,可以使用以下 SQL 命令:
SHOW DATABASES;这会列出所有当前 MySQL 服务器中存在的数据库。当然,如果你拥有足够的权限,还可以使用以下的 SQL 命令来查看数据库的详细信息:
SELECT * FROM information_schema.SCHEMATA;这样会返回更多关于数据库的信息,比如数据库的默认字符集、默认排序规则等。
另外,如果需要在特定服务器上执行这样的查询,你需要首先连接到数据库系统,可以使用以下命令:
mysql -u 用户名 -p然后输入密码,即可连接到数据库系统,然后就可以执行上述的 SQL 查询语句。
值得一提的是,当使用
SHOW DATABASES;命令时,最终的结果可能如下所示:+--------------------+ | Database | +--------------------+ | information_schema | | mysql | | performance_schema | | sys | | your_database_name | +--------------------+你可以在这个列表中看到默认的数据库,例如
information_schema、mysql以及performance_schema。这些是 MySQL 系统自带的数据库。而your_database_name则是用户创建的自定义数据库。1年前 -
在MySQL中,可以使用以下命令来查询当前MySQL实例中有哪些数据库:
SHOW DATABASES;执行上述命令后,MySQL将会返回一个包含所有数据库名称的列表。在这个列表中,可能会包含一些系统自带的数据库,比如
mysql,information_schema和performance_schema等。另外,也可以通过一些其他方法来查询数据库,比如通过连接到MySQL实例后,使用类似
DESC、SHOW TABLES等SQL语句来查看数据库中的具体信息。此外,也可以通过数据库管理工具,如MySQL Workbench、phpMyAdmin等来查看数据库的列表。总的来说,在MySQL中,通过执行
SHOW DATABASES;命令是最直接简单的方式来查看当前MySQL实例中有哪些数据库。1年前 -
要查询MySQL中存在哪些数据库,可以使用以下方法:
-
使用命令行工具
- 打开命令行工具(如Windows的命令提示符或PowerShell,或者在Linux/Unix系统中使用终端)
- 输入以下命令并按回车键:
SHOW DATABASES; - 这将显示MySQL服务器上的所有数据库列表。
-
使用MySQL客户端
- 打开MySQL客户端工具,如MySQL Workbench、Navicat等。
- 连接到MySQL服务器。
- 运行以下命令:
SHOW DATABASES;
-
使用编程语言和MySQL连接器
- 如果你使用编程语言(如Python、Java等)连接到MySQL数据库,可以编写代码来执行查询并获取数据库列表。
- 以下是一个使用Python中的
mysql-connector连接器来查询数据库列表的示例代码:import mysql.connector # 连接到MySQL服务器 cnx = mysql.connector.connect(user='username', password='password', host='hostname', database='information_schema') # 创建游标对象 cursor = cnx.cursor() # 执行查询 cursor.execute("SHOW DATABASES") # 获取结果 for (database_name,) in cursor: print(database_name) # 关闭游标和连接 cursor.close() cnx.close()
不论是使用命令行工具、MySQL客户端还是编程语言,上述方法都可以用来查询MySQL服务器上存在哪些数据库。
1年前 -


